7. Helps Control Blood Sugar
The fiber in cucumbers slows carbohydrate digestion, preventing blood sugar spikes. Some studies suggest cucumber extracts may even help lower blood sugar levels, making them a smart choice for diabetics.
8. Strengthens Bones
Cucumbers are a good source of vitamin K, which improves calcium absorption and bone density. Eating them regularly may help prevent osteoporosis and fractures.

Potential Downsides to Watch For
While cucumbers are incredibly healthy, overeating them may cause:
Bloating or gas (due to cucurbitacins).
Interference with blood thinners (because of vitamin K content).
Pesticide exposure (opt for organic or wash thoroughly).
